The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Electronics in permanent job vacancies advertised in the South East.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Electronics over the 6 months to 23 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period over the previous 2 years.

6 months to
23 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 93 111 136
Rank change year-on-year +18 +25 +31
Permanent jobs citing Electronics 482 437 516
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the South East 2.90% 2.87% 2.62%
As % of the General category 5.13% 4.47% 4.53%
Number of salaries quoted 277 176 237
10th Percentile £32,500 £26,250 £36,050
25th Percentile £38,500 £37,938 £41,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£47,500 £52,500 £50,000
Median % change year-on-year -9.52% +5.00% +11.11%
75th Percentile £62,500 £74,063 £62,500
90th Percentile £70,000 £75,000 £75,000
England median annual salary £52,500 £52,500 £52,500
% change year-on-year - - -4.55%
